π‘ What is PiProxyHub?
PiProxyHub is a preconfigured system that turns your Raspberry Pi into a plug-and-play USB proxy server.
Designed for automation, remote access, and developers who need mobile IPs with real SIM cards.
With it, you can:
- Use USB modems (dongles) to create residential mobile proxies
- Manage multiple IPs through ports automatically
- Access proxies over LAN or remotely
- Avoid complex Linux setups or configurations
π§° What You Need
- A Raspberry Pi (3, 4, or Zero 2 W)
- A reliable power supply
- At least one USB modem (SIM-enabled)
- Network access (Ethernet or Wi-Fi)
